Ensure you are using a high-quality USB port or a direct SATA connection. SATA-to-USB adapters often lack enough power for flashing.
If your SM2259XT drive has already failed and identifies with a generic name or 0MB capacity, stop applying power. Every boot cycle forces the controller to attempt background garbage collection, which can permanently overwrite the remaining remnants of your data tables.
The SM2259XT is a single-channel, DRAM-less SATA 6Gb/s SSD controller designed by Silicon Motion. Because it lacks a dedicated DRAM cache chip to store its translation layer tables, it handles all lookup mappings directly within its internal SRAM and the drive's NAND flash memory. Key Technical Specifications SATA 6Gb/s
Because the SM2259XT must constantly write its own mapping tables back to the slow, volatile NAND flash, it is highly susceptible to wear and sudden structural interruptions. Firmware corruption in these drives rarely occurs because the read-only microcode changes; rather, it occurs because the becomes unreadable or desynchronized. The Cycle of Failure sm2259xt firmware
If power is cut while the controller is writing a new iteration of the FTL map to the NAND, the map becomes incomplete or corrupted.
Click or manually select your verified NAND flash configuration from the drop-down menu.
: Frequently use this controller but are often cited for higher failure rates due to lower-quality flash or less-optimized firmware. APH Networks firmware update tool for a specific SSD brand, or are you trying to recover data from a drive that isn't being detected? SM2259 / SM2259XT - Silicon Motion Ensure you are using a high-quality USB port
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.
. Because it is DRAM-less, it relies on advanced firmware algorithms and SLC caching to maintain speeds during typical consumer workloads. Reliability Features: Includes proprietary NANDXtend ECC technology
The SM2259XT is a workhorse controller for budget SSDs, and understanding its firmware is essential for anyone looking to diagnose, repair, or customize these drives. While flashing firmware is not a task for the average user, the robust MPTool ecosystem provides a powerful, low-level solution for breathing new life into a bricked drive or resurrecting an old one. By carefully identifying your hardware, finding the exact matching firmware package, and following a methodical process, you can successfully master the firmware of your SM2259XT-based SSD. Every boot cycle forces the controller to attempt
Click on the tab. (If prompted for a password, it is typically left blank, or use 321 ).
PC-3000 SSD. Beyond TRIM: QUMO SSD SM2259XT| Part 1
If you are dealing with a failed drive right now, I can help you evaluate your options. Let me know: What is the of the SSD?
Silicon Motion offers two closely related controllers: the and the SM2259XT . The primary difference lies in the presence of DRAM. The SM2259 utilizes an external DRAM cache to store mapping tables, which can lead to faster access times. The SM2259XT , however, is a "DRAM-less" design, meaning it lacks this external cache, significantly reducing the Bill of Materials (BOM) cost for manufacturers. It relies on the Host Memory Buffer (HMB) feature of the SATA protocol to use a small portion of your computer's RAM for the same purpose. This makes the SM2259XT a popular choice for budget-friendly drives, including models like the Mushkin Source, Patriot Burst Elite, and countless others from brands like Teamgroup.
Typical UART pins on an SM2259XT PCB (example):